小虎建站知识网,分享建站知识,包括:建站行业动态、建站百科知识、SEO优化知识等知识。建站服务热线:180-5191-0076

动态html的简称;动态html的核心技术

  • 动态,html,的,简称,核心,技术,DHTML,Dynam
  • 建站百科知识-小虎建站百科知识网
  • 2026-02-16 07:01
  • 小虎建站百科知识网

动态html的简称;动态html的核心技术 ,对于想了解建站百科知识的朋友们来说,动态html的简称;动态html的核心技术是一个非常想了解的问题,下面小编就带领大家看看这个问题。

DHTML(Dynamic HTML)作为90年代Web技术的里程碑,至今仍是现代前端开发的基石。它并非单一技术,而是HTML、CSS、JavaScript和DOM技术融合的"化学方程式",让网页从静态文档进化为会呼吸的数字化生命体。本文将带您穿透技术迷雾,揭开DHTML六大核心技术的魔法面纱。

DOM:网页的神经元网络

文档对象模型(DOM)是DHTML的神经中枢,它将网页转化为可编程的树状结构。当开发者通过JavaScript修改DOM节点时,网页会像被施了变形咒般实时响应。

现代浏览器已实现Level 3 DOM标准,支持XPath查询和事件冒泡捕获等高级功能。例如通过`document.getElementById`选择元素,再使用`appendChild`动态添加内容,这种操作如同在虚拟世界进行显微手术。

更惊人的是Shadow DOM技术,它像给网页元素套上"隐身衣",创建独立的样式和作用域。Chrome开发者工具中灰色的shadow-root标记,正是这个平行宇宙的入口。

CSSOM:视觉的魔法画笔

动态html的简称;动态html的核心技术

CSS对象模型(CSSOM)让样式表变成可脚本操控的属性库。通过JavaScript修改`element.style`属性,能实现像素级的视觉魔法——比如让按钮在悬停时像水母般渐变发光。

动态样式最震撼的应用是CSS变量(Custom Properties)。通过`document.documentElement.style.setProperty`修改`:root`变量值,整个页面的配色方案能在毫秒间切换,如同给网站施展"变色龙咒语"。

新兴的Houdini API更将CSSOM的潜力释放到极致,开发者可以直接介入浏览器的渲染管线,创作出以前只能靠黑科技实现的流体动画效果。

事件驱动:网页的反射弧

从最简单的`onclick`到复杂的自定义事件,DHTML的事件系统构建了人机交互的神经反射弧。现代浏览器支持的`addEventListener`方法,允许像挂载多个监听器,形成精密的交互逻辑网。

触摸事件(touchstart/touchmove)的引入让网页有了触觉感知。在移动设备上,通过计算两点触摸距离实现的缩放操作,背后是`GestureEvent`这套精密的生物反馈模拟系统。

更前沿的是Pointer Events统一接口,它能同时处理鼠标、触控笔和手指输入,就像给网页装上了跨物种的感知器官。

异步通信:数据的暗物质

AJAX技术是DHTML的"幻影移形"咒语,让页面无需刷新就能获取数据。从早期的XMLHttpRequest到现代的Fetch API,数据传输速度已从拨号上网时代的"蜗牛信使"进化到5G时代的"闪电侠"。

WebSocket则建立了双向通信隧道,就像在浏览器和服务器间架设了量子纠缠通道。股票行情推送、在线游戏同步等实时场景中,数据包以光速在TCP长连接中穿梭。

Server-Sent Events(SSE)更开创了单向数据流的新范式,适合新闻推送这类场景,如同给网页安装了永不断电的信息收音机。

动态渲染:视觉的量子态

Canvas API让网页获得直接操纵像素的能力,2D绘图上下文如同数字画布。通过`requestAnimationFrame`实现的动画,能达到影院级60FPS流畅度,就像给浏览器装上了显卡引擎。

SVG动态修改则展现了矢量图形的魔力,通过脚本调整``元素的d属性,能让图标像橡皮筋般自由变形。D3.js这类库正是利用此特性,将数据转化为会跳舞的信息图。

最令人惊叹的是WebGL技术,它通过OpenGL ES接口将GPU算力注入网页。Three.js构建的3D世界会随鼠标移动产生视差变化,创造出身临其境的VR前体验。

存储魔法:记忆的冥想盆

从4KB的cookie到2.5MB的Web Storage,DHTML的本地存储如同不断扩容的记忆宫殿。localStorage的持久化特性,让网页应用在断电后仍能保持状态,像被施了"保鲜咒"。

IndexedDB则构建了前端数据库帝国,支持事务处理和复杂查询。一个音乐PWA应用可能在此存储数百MB的音频缓存,实现离线播放的魔法效果。

Cache API与Service Worker的组合更是革命性的,它们让网页获得类似原生应用的安装能力,即使没有网络连接也能加载,如同给网站施加了"不死鸟咒文"。

动态html的简称;动态html的核心技术

DHTML:永不落幕的进化史诗

从1997年IE4首次实现动态内容更新,到如今Web Components打造的组件化未来,DHTML始终站在人机交互革命的最前沿。它既是技术融合的典范,也是开发者创造力的试金石。当WebAssembly等新技术不断加入这个生态,DHTML的定义边界将持续扩展——唯一不变的,是它让网页"活"起来的核心使命。在元宇宙崛起的今天,这些技术正在编织下一代互联网的神经网络。

以上是关于动态html的简称;动态html的核心技术的介绍,希望对想了解建站百科知识的朋友们有所帮助。

本文标题:动态html的简称;动态html的核心技术;本文链接:https://zwz66.cn/jianz/134357.html。

Copyright © 2002-2027 小虎建站知识网 版权所有    网站备案号: 苏ICP备18016903号-19     苏公网安备苏公网安备32031202000909


中国互联网诚信示范企业 违法和不良信息举报中心 网络110报警服务 中国互联网协会 诚信网站